*** This bug is a duplicate of bug 1988087 *** https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1988087 That's not the correct way to tell whether the Power Mode has been changed. The GNOME Quick Settings feature in the top right of the screen has a complicated Power Mode switcher. The power mode button toggles between Balanced and whichever mode you selected last. Therefore, it needs to keep track of the last power mode selected that isn't Balanced. That's all that dconf/gsettings value is showing you. You can get your current power mode by running this command: powerprofilesctl get I'm going to close this bug since I believe the issues here are fixed.
